Quartzsite Roadrunners Gem & Mineral Club 65 Ironwood, PO Box 338 Quartzsite, AZ 85346 928-927-6363 www.qrgmc.org Quartzsite Roadrunners Gem & Mineral Club In 2009 then Mayor Wes Hunt- ley made a proclamation de- claring the Town of Quartzsite the "Rock Capital of the World." Quartzsite is well-known for its many gem and mineral shows and year-round vendors of rocks, geodes, and treasures. Mines surround the area, and rock landscaping or "hard- scape" is commonplace in snowbird yards. Rockhound- ing is a favorite winter pas- time, and there are organiza- tions, such as the Roadrunner Gem and Mineral Club and the Quartzsite Metal Detecting Club, that have hunts, classes, club meetings and events. www.QuartzsiteAZ.org
